Sebastijan Antić (born 5 November 1992) is a Croatian professional footballer who plays as a centre-back for Croatian Football League club Lokomotiva Zagreb.

Club career

On 7 August 2019 it was confirmed, that Antić had signed with FC Atyrau in Kazakhstan.[1] However, due to problems with getting his players license, he left the club again and signed with HNK Orijent 1919 two weeks later.[2]

In January 2020, Antic joined Sahab SC in Jordan.[3][4] On 30 September 2020 SILA, a law company, confirmed that FIFA condemned the club to pay to the player outstanding remuneration and compensation for breach of contract..[5] On 18 September 2020, he joined Al-Mesaimeer SC in Qatar.[6]

In August 2024, he officially signed a contract with Indonesian club PSMS Medan.[7]
